Making Sushi
Thanks to my mother-in-law, I now love making Sushi. It is much easier than what I expected. Here is how I did it.

Take 1 cup of sushi rice and mix a little less than 1 1/4 cup of water. I just eye balled it and made the rice in a rice cooker.
After rice is done and is warm mix a few teaspoons of Japanese rice vinegar.
I made two kinds. One mixture was: imitation crab, carrots, cucumber, and avocado. The other was: cream cheese, smoke salmon, cucumber, and carrots.
Take a bamboo rolling mat and line with wax paper. Spread a layer of rice and place a some nori (seaweed) on top of it. Fill with either of the mixutres above. Then roll.
Serve with mixture of wasabi and soy sauce.
